Overview

Dive deeper into prototyping for Android with Jetpack Compose in this comprehensive video tutorial. Learn how to manage state for interactive Compose apps and utilize built-in components like Backdrop. Explore the basics of state management, understand the use of slots in Compose, and build a Backdrop app bar with front layer and menu. Discover how to add selection state to the Backdrop menu, enhancing user interaction. Follow along as Chris Sinco, an Interaction Designer on the Android Developer tools team, guides you through each step, from intro to outro. Access the accompanying GitHub repository for hands-on practice and download Android Studio to start implementing these concepts in your own projects.
